Any time you plug in a different device to your modem you have to restart your modem, so you can try that. I know from experience that Arris modems are fucking bullshit and they crap out easily. What I recommend you do is just wire your xbox to your router because as long as your not wireless you should notice close to no speed difference while wired. I'm almost always game host for any COD game I play.
Go to 192.168.100.1 and tell me what your signal to noise ratio is and give me a summary of what your event log for DOCSIS events is saying. If there are any problems while your xbox is wired up it should have logged them, you could also wire your xbox up and keep track of the time then wire the modem back up to your computer and tell me if anything got logged while your xbox was wired.
